Bash漏洞测试,守护你的系统安全

喜羊羊

随着信息技术的快速发展,计算机系统的安全性问题日益受到关注,Bash作为Unix和Linux系统中广泛使用的shell程序,其安全性问题尤为关键,Bash漏洞测试是保障系统安全的重要一环,通过发现潜在的安全风险,及时采取防范措施,防止黑客利用Bash漏洞入侵系统,本文将介绍Bash漏洞测试的基本概念、方法以及应对策略。

Bash漏洞测试,守护你的系统安全

Bash漏洞测试概述

Bash漏洞测试是对Bash程序进行安全检测的过程,旨在发现Bash程序中的安全漏洞,安全漏洞是指计算机系统中的弱点,可能导致未经授权的访问、数据泄露或系统崩溃等问题,Bash漏洞测试通过模拟黑客的攻击行为,检测Bash程序在各种场景下的安全性,从而发现潜在的安全风险。

Bash漏洞测试方法

静态代码分析

静态代码分析是一种通过检查源代码来发现安全漏洞的方法,通过对Bash源代码进行静态分析,可以发现潜在的代码错误、逻辑错误以及安全漏洞,静态代码分析需要使用专业的代码分析工具,如SonarQube、FindBugs等。

动态漏洞扫描

动态漏洞扫描是通过在实际运行环境中模拟攻击行为来检测安全漏洞的方法,在Bash漏洞测试中,可以使用动态扫描工具对Bash程序进行实时监控,检测程序在运行过程中的异常行为,从而发现潜在的安全风险,常见的动态扫描工具包括Nmap、Nessus等。

模糊测试

模糊测试是一种通过输入大量随机或特殊构造的数据来检测程序安全性的方法,在Bash漏洞测试中,模糊测试可以通过生成大量随机命令或参数,检测Bash程序的异常处理能力,从而发现潜在的安全漏洞。

Bash漏洞测试策略

定期测试

定期进行Bash漏洞测试是保障系统安全的重要措施,随着Bash版本的更新,新的安全漏洞可能会被暴露出来,定期测试可以及时发现新出现的安全问题,并采取相应的防范措施。

选择合适的测试工具

选择合适的测试工具是Bash漏洞测试的关键,不同的测试工具具有不同的特点和优势,应根据实际需求选择合适的工具进行测试,可以使用多个工具进行测试,以提高测试的准确性和全面性。

修复已知漏洞

一旦发现Bash程序存在安全漏洞,应及时修复,修复已知漏洞是防止黑客利用漏洞入侵系统的关键,在修复漏洞时,应遵循安全开发规范,确保修复过程的安全性。

加强安全防护措施

除了进行Bash漏洞测试外,还应加强系统的安全防护措施,限制用户权限、使用防火墙、定期更新操作系统和应用程序等,这些措施可以有效提高系统的安全性,防止黑客入侵。

Bash漏洞测试是保障系统安全的重要一环,通过静态代码分析、动态扫描和模糊测试等方法,可以发现Bash程序中的安全漏洞,并及时采取防范措施,应定期测试、选择合适的测试工具、修复已知漏洞并加强安全防护措施,本文介绍了Bash漏洞测试的基本概念、方法以及应对策略,希望能对读者在保障系统安全方面提供帮助,随着信息技术的不断发展,我们应持续关注Bash等关键软件的安全性问题,加强安全防护意识,共同维护网络安全。

建议

  1. 加强对Bash等关键软件的安全研究,提高安全防御能力。
  2. 鼓励企业和个人参与开源项目的安全维护,共同提高软件的安全性。
  3. 提高安全意识,加强网络安全教育,培养更多的网络安全人才。
  4. 政府部门应加大对网络安全问题的投入,提高网络安全防护能力。

Bash漏洞测试是保障系统安全的重要措施,我们应关注Bash等关键软件的安全性问题,加强安全防护意识,共同维护网络安全。

文章版权声明:除非注明,否则均为欣依网原创文章,转载或复制请以超链接形式并注明出处。

发表评论

快捷回复: 表情:
AddoilApplauseBadlaughBombCoffeeFabulousFacepalmFecesFrownHeyhaInsidiousKeepFightingNoProbPigHeadShockedSinistersmileSlapSocialSweatTolaughWatermelonWittyWowYeahYellowdog
评论列表 (暂无评论,1人围观)

还没有评论,来说两句吧...

目录[+]